What P0303 usually means
P0303 means the ECU is tracking the misfire pattern mainly on cylinder 3. The likely causes are usually similar to other single-cylinder misfire codes, but the exact component layout depends on the engine.
Quick answer: Misfire was primarily detected on cylinder 3.

If cylinder 3 is actively misfiring, drive as little as possible until the cause is confirmed.
Cause phrases often tied to this code: ignition failure, injector fault, compression issue.
